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Varios (https://www.clubdelphi.com/foros/forumdisplay.php?f=11)
-   -   Ordenar Ttable por fecha (https://www.clubdelphi.com/foros/showthread.php?t=29269)

Iskariote0087 17-01-2006 19:55:19

Ordenar Ttable por fecha
 
Hola, vuelvo a ser yo, otra vez.

Vereis, tengo unos datos que los guardo en un Ttable al recuperarlos me interasa recuperar todos pero ordenados por uno de los campos, 'Hora', pero no me interasa utilizar una SQL, la pregunta es: puedo ordenar los registros de una tabla utilizando un Ttable o tengo que utilar por fuerza una SQL.

Un saludete
Iskariote

roman 17-01-2006 20:56:02

Si tienes un índice para el campo fecha, bastará que lo selecciones en la componente Table. Por otra parte, ¿por qué no te interesa usar SQL? ¿Qué de malo hay en ello?

// Saludos

Iskariote0087 17-01-2006 21:23:50

Agradecimiento
 
Lo primero, gracias por tu respuesta, y lo segundo,cuando comence el prog guardaba en una misma tabla los registros dados de alta hoy, mñ,pasado,etc... Entonces al recuperarlos como solo me interesa recuperar los del dia en curso utilizaba una SQL, pero los datos los presento en un DBGrid y la verdad no iva nada bien porque lo cargaba de uno en uno y cada vez que daba de alta un registro como tambien lo tenia que mostrar en el DBGrid tenia que desactivar y volver a activar la SQL, por lo tanto cada vez que daba de alta un registro se volvia a cargar la SQL uno a uno.Pero ahora como he decidido que cada mñ cuando arranque el prog si la fecha que tengo en la tabla es distinta a la del equipo hago una copia de seguridad y dejo la tabla vacia, con lo cual para recuperar ahora no necesito SQL porque recupero toda la tabla y te aseguro que va como un tiro no te das cuenta como se carga.No se si es que yo estaba haciendo algo mal o que, pero con el Ttable no me pasa. Te he soltado un rollo que 'pa que' espero que mi hallas enterado.
Gracias por contestar.
Un saludete
Iskariote:eek:

ContraVeneno 17-01-2006 22:05:50

Pues supongo qeu algo estaría mal enfocado en ese aspecto (usar sql), porque en muchos casos es mucho más rápido y sencillo realizar una consulta, que extraer toda la tabla. Será que no comprendí la parte de que "cargar uno a uno" en un dbgrid usando una consulta. :confused:

En fin, un "order by" por fecha creo sería lo más adecuado.


La franja horaria es GMT +2. Ahora son las 05:42:34.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i